What is crucial to communicate during the response to a terrorist incident?

During a response to a terrorist incident, it is vital to communicate essential information that aids in organizing an adequate and effective response. This information includes details about the situation, such as the nature of the threat, the location of the incident, and the specific needs for resources and personnel. Ensuring that first responders and command centers have access to timely and accurate data enables them to make informed decisions quickly, which is critical for minimizing harm and facilitating rescue operations.

Effective communication helps coordinate efforts among various agencies, ensures the safety of responders and civilians, and allows for the implementation of necessary tactics to address the incident. Providing information that specifically drives the operational response is fundamental to managing the incident effectively and restoring safety.
